Here's the core of it: OEM for Komatsu doesn't mean it rolled off the Komatsu assembly line in Japan. It means it was manufactured by a company that is part of the Komatsu supply chain, a factory that holds the blueprints and the material specs to produce that exact gear 17A-27-11261. The quality can be, and often is, functionally identical. The metallurgy, the heat treatment, the grinding tolerances—they have to hit Komatsu's marks. But the Original tag, that's for the parts packaged in the Komatsu box, with the Komatsu part number laser-etched, distributed through the official channels. The price difference is significant. The performance difference? In my experience, often negligible for the OEM-sourced unit, provided your source is legitimate.

But—and there's always a but—the risk is in the certain countries part. The aftermarket is flooded with copies. A part can be OEM-spec but not from the OEM factory Komatsu uses. The difference might be in a secondary process, like a coating or a specific testing protocol that gets skipped. I've installed gears that looked perfect, met all caliper checks, but developed a harmonic whine after 200 hours that the genuine part never had. Tracing it back, it was likely a sub-tier foundry that the supplier was using, still calling it OEM. That's the gamble.
So, how do you vet it? The part number 17A-27-11261 is just the start. You need to ask the supplier for the manufacturing traceability. A proper OEM supplier, one truly embedded in the system, should be able to provide batch codes or even factory identifiers. When I deal with a company like the one mentioned, I'd probe directly: Is this from the HCP factory or the SKF bearing unit that Komatsu sources for this assembly? Their answer tells you everything. If they're vague, it's a red flag. If they can specify, it builds trust.
The physical inspection is telling. A genuine Komatsu part will have crisp, clean markings. The OEM part from the sanctioned factory will too, but it might lack the Komatsu logo or have a different branding on the raw casting. The finish on the gear teeth is a dead giveaway—a polished, consistent finish versus a rougher, machined look. The packaging is another clue. Official Komatsu parts come in specific, high-quality boxes with multilingual manuals. OEM parts might come in simpler, unbranded or supplier-branded boxes. That doesn't mean the part is inferior; it just means you're not paying for the packaging and the global logistics markup.

There are scenarios where I would never recommend deviating from the genuine original Komatsu part. The biggest one is warranty status. If the machine is under Komatsu warranty, installing a non-genuine part on a major component like a final drive gear can void the entire related system warranty. It's not worth the risk. The dealer will scan the part's RFID or check the markings, and if it doesn't match their system, you're on the hook.
Another is for very new models. The 17A-27-11261 number has been around, but when a completely new model series launches, the OEM supply chain takes time to ramp up. The first year or so, the only OEM parts available might be reverse-engineered copies, not true OEM-spec. In that window, genuine is the only safe bet. Also, if the failure mode of the original gear was unusual—not just wear, but a catastrophic shear or pitting from a suspected heat treat issue—you want the genuine replacement. Komatsu's genuine part might have a silent running change or improvement that the open-market OEM hasn't adopted yet.

Let's talk numbers and time. A genuine Komatsu gear 17A-27-11261 might have a list price of, say, $1,200. The OEM equivalent from a certified supplier might land at $750. That's a substantial saving. But you must factor in the logistics. A genuine part ordered through a local dealer has a defined, if sometimes long, delivery path. An OEM part from an international supplier like Gaosong might come via air freight or sea freight. You need to manage customs, potential delays, and import duties. The $450 saving can evaporate if you need it air-freighted in an emergency.
